To unpack the 871 Advanced Bioscan, lift it from its box by both

hands. Never lift the 871 Advanc

n at its front doors, but at its

sides.

2.1.4

Arrangement of the instruments

In general, the IC pumps should be set up at the very bottom and the

IC detectors at the very top.
